Abstract

An OLED display and touch screen system including a substrate; an OLED display including an array of individually addressable OLEDs formed on the substrate; and a touch screen including an OLED light emitter formed on the substrate and a light sensor formed on the substrate across the display from the light emitter, and optics located around the display above the light emitter and the light sensor for directing light emitted from the light emitter across the display to the light sensor.

Claims (30)

1. An OLED display and touch screen system, comprising:

a) a substrate;

b) an OLED display including an array of individually addressable OLEDs formed on the substrate; and

c) a touch screen including an OLED light emitter formed on the substrate and a light sensor formed on the substrate across the display from the light emitter, and optics located around the display above the light emitter and the light sensor for directing light emitted from the light emitter across the display to the light sensor, wherein the OLED light emitter and the light sensor of the touch screen are integrated on the substrate with the individually addressable OLEDs of the OLED display.

2. The OLED display and touch screen claimed in claim 1 , wherein the OLED light emitter is a linear array of individually addressable OLEDs and the light sensor is a linear array of light detecting elements.

3. The OLED display and touch screen claimed in claim 2 , wherein the OLEDs of the OLED light emitter and the light detecting elements are interspersed in a plurality of linear arrays.

4. The OLED display and touch screen claimed in claim 2 , further comprising control electronics for sequentially activating the OLEDs of the OLED light emitter.

5. The OLED display and touch screen claimed in claim 2 , further comprising control electronics for simultaneously activating the OLEDs of the OLED light emitter.

6. The OLED display and touch screen claimed in claim 1 , further comprising control electronics for activating the OLED light emitter in a predetermined temporal pattern and for filtering an output from the light sensor to detect the predetermined pattern.

7. The OLED display and touch screen claimed in claim 1 , further comprising unitary control electronics for controlling both the OLED display and the touch screen.

8. The OLED display and touch screen claimed in claim 1 , wherein the light sensor is a non-organic light detecting element.

9. The OLED display and touch screen claimed in claim 8 , wherein the non-organic light detecting element is a silicon light detecting element.

10. The OLED display and touch screen claimed in claim 1 , wherein the OLED light emitter is a linear OLED and the light sensor is a linear array of light detecting elements.

11. The OLED display and touch screen claimed in claim 1 , wherein the OLED display is a top emitting display.

12. The OLED display and touch screen claimed in claim 1 , wherein the OLED display is a bottom emitting display.

13. The OLED display and touch screen claimed in claim 1 , wherein the OLED light emitter emits infrared light.

14. The OLED display and touch screen claimed in claim 1 , wherein the optics are 45 degree mirrors.

15. The OLED display and touch screen claimed in claim 14 , further comprising a frame surrounding the OLED display, and wherein the 45 degree mirrors are supported by the frame.

16. The OLED display and touch screen claimed in claim 14 , further comprising a frame surrounding the OLED display, and wherein the 45 degree mirrors are formed on the frame.

17. The OLED display and touch screen claimed in claim 16 , including an enclosure for the display wherein the frame is a portion of the enclosure.

18. The OLED display and touch screen claimed in claim 1 , wherein the optics comprise light pipes.
